Zulte Waregem v Norwich City: Follow live pre-season updates

On July 19, 2025, SV Zulte Waregem faced Norwich City in a pre-season friendly at the Elindus Arena, marking an important step in both teams’ preparations for the upcoming season. This match not only served as a platform for players to showcase their skills but also provided fans with a glimpse of what to expect in the months ahead.
Match Overview
The friendly match kicked off at 7 PM local time, with both teams eager to test their squads ahead of the new season. Zulte Waregem, a Belgian Pro League side, was looking to build on their previous season’s performance, while Norwich City, recently relegated from the Premier League, aimed to regroup and prepare for a strong campaign in the Championship.
